Transaction 86038dd7c55116e0610966a454fb83853a02bb2b1d050107a0fc0e15e1491d82
1 Input
1 Output
-
86038dd7c55116e0610966a454fb83853a02bb2b1d050107a0fc0e15e1491d82:0
- value
- 564775846
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e69fddd1c0b32c5eaab9a9b3923f9d3f87c2f92 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QCDc9wqKjTGFhtuZUmTD437CxdRNWU2FU